Learning About Bed Bugs: Identification and Behavior

Bed bugs, small parasitic insects belonging to the Cimex lectularius species, are notorious for their ability to prevent rest and produce distress. Recognizable by their flat, oval bodies and mahogany-colored coloration, adult bed bugs reach about review now a quarter of an inch in length. Their size and shape allow them to hide easily in fissures and edges of furniture, bedding, and walls.

Bed bugs are mainly nocturnal, consuming the blood of their hosts during the night. They are drawn to CO2 and thermal energy, making humans ideal hosts. Breeding happens rapidly; a single female can lay hundreds of eggs in her lifetime. Comprehending the behavior and habits of bed bugs is essential for effective management, as they can quickly infest homes and remain inactive for prolonged timeframes. Their resilience to environmental changes highlights the importance of early detection and intervention.

Necessary Resources for Efficient DIY Pest Eradication

A well-planned DIY bed bug treatment approach is required, and having the correct tools is important for achieving success. Essential tools comprise a excellent quality vacuum cleaner equipped with a HEPA filter, which effectively extracts bed bugs and their eggs from assorted surfaces. Steamers are also essential; the extreme heat kill bed bugs upon contact, making them perfect for handling mattresses and upholstery.

Bed bug interceptors can be set under leg supports to trap and observe any pests attempting to climb. Additionally, protective covers for mattresses and box springs prevent pest problems and protect against future invasions. A good flashlight is necessary for thorough inspections in dark areas, while alcohol solution can act as a quick targeted fix.

At last, a durable brush aids in dislodging bugs from crevices. Together, these tools form a extensive arsenal for tackling bed bug infestations successfully.

Effective Home Cures for Bed Bug Eradication

Homeowners looking for relief from bed bug infestations often rely on established remedies that can be located in their own kitchens or local stores. One effective approach involves using natural oils, especially tea tree and lavender oil, recognized for their insect-repellent properties. Mixing these oils with water and spraying them on affected areas may help deterring bed bugs. Another standard remedy is diatomaceous earth, a natural powder that dehydrates the bugs upon contact, effectively eliminating them over time.

Freezing items that cannot be washed, such as shoes or stuffed animals, for several days can also get rid of bed bugs. Moreover, a meticulous vacuuming of infested areas followed by steam cleaning can disturb their habitats. While these home remedies may not ensure complete eradication, they can function as beneficial adjuncts to a broad pest control strategy. Homeowners should be vigilant and observe for any signs of resurgence.

Protecting Against Forthcoming Bed Bug Invasions

After obtaining expert pest control treatment, attention must turn to avoiding subsequent pest problems. Implementing proactive measures is essential to keeping your space free from bed bugs. First, frequent checks of sleeping areas and surrounding furniture can help detect any early signs of bed bugs. Utilizing protective mattress and box spring encasements establishes a protective shield that prevents bed bugs from hiding and breeding.

In addition, it is essential to be cautious when journeying. Inspecting hotel rooms and holding luggage lifted can minimize the risk of bringing bed bugs home. Organizing living spaces also reduces potential hiding spots, making it easier to spot any infestations early.

Additionally, making aware all household members about bed bug indicators and prevention strategies establishes a shared accountability. By adopting these methods, residents can significantly minimize the odds of a bed bug problem down the line, thereby maintaining a pleasant, pest-free home.

Everyday Habits for Preserving a Bed Bug-Free Home

Maintaining a pest-free house entails consistent daily habits that reduce the risk of infestations. Regularly inspecting beds is crucial; searching for signs such as exuviae or marks on bedding helps detect problems early. Washing bedding and linens on a weekly basis in hot water is another useful method, since high temperatures kill any potential eggs or bugs.

Regular vacuuming, notably in areas where pets sleep and along baseboards, can destroy hidden bed bugs and their eggs. Keeping clutter to a minimum also aids in prevention, as it gives fewer hiding spots.

When traveling, individuals should inspect hotel rooms and place luggage elevated on racks rather than on beds or floors. Additionally, sealing cracks and crevices in walls or furniture can greatly decrease the chances of bed bug entry. Adopting these regular practices fosters a proactive approach to preserving a pest-free environment.

How Extended Will Bed Bugs Remain Without a Host?

Bed bugs are able to live without a host for a number of months, typically ranging from two to six months. Their toughness permits them to survive in environments devoid of food, seeking a proper host to show up.

Do Bed Bugs transmit Diseases to Humans?

Based on guidance from health experts, bed bugs do not communicate diseases to humans. Their bites can cause discomfort and allergic episodes, but they are not noted carriers of pathogens that lead to infections or serious illnesses.

Can Your Animals Transmit Bed Bugs Into the Home?

Pets are able to unintentionally carry bed bugs into your residence by collecting them from infested areas. While bed bugs do not usually infest pets, they can travel on fur or possessions.

Is It Secure to Apply Insecticides Around Young Children?

Using insecticides around children can create potential hazards. It's essential to follow label instructions, guarantee proper ventilation, and keep kids away during treatment. Speaking with a pest control expert can offer safer alternatives and guidance for family environments.

What signs show that my bed bug treatment succeeded?

To confirm if bed bug treatment was working, one should check for evidence such as bites, cast skins, or visible bugs for several weeks. Regular inspections and follow-up treatments may be necessary for thorough eradication.
